DANKO v. REDWAY ENTERPRISES, INC.

(AC 17736)

53 Conn. App. 373 (1999)

CONSTANCE DANKO ET AL. v. REDWAY ENTERPRISES, INC., ET AL.

Appellate Court of Connecticut.

Officially released May 18, 1999.


Attorney(s) appearing for the Case

Joshua D. Koskoff, for the appellants (plaintiffs).

Eric P. Smith, with whom was Donn A. Swift, for the appellee (named defendant).

O'Connell, C. J., and Lavery and Hennessy, Js.


Opinion

LAVERY, J.

The plaintiffs, Stanley Danko and Constance Danko, appeal from the judgment rendered following the trial court's denial of their motion to set aside the verdict rendered in favor of the defendant Redway Enterprises, Inc. (Redway). The sole issue on appeal is whether the trial court improperly excluded from evidence Redway's stricken apportionment complaint. We affirm the judgment of the trial court.
